Yeshivath Beth Moshe vs. Wofford College Cost Comparison

Which college is more expensive, Yeshivath Beth Moshe or Wofford College?

  • Wofford College is 397.6% more expensive to attend than Yeshivath Beth Moshe for in-state tuition ($49,760.00 vs. $10,000.00)
  • Out of state tuition is 397.6% higher at Wofford College than Yeshivath Beth Moshe ($49,760.00 vs. $10,000.00)
  • The typical actual cost that students pay to attend (average net price) is less at Yeshivath Beth Moshe than Wofford College ($5,765 vs. $31,192)
  • Living costs (room and board or off-campus housing budget) at Yeshivath Beth Moshe are 314.4% lower than costs at Wofford College ($3,600 vs. $14,920)
  • More students receive financial grant aid at Wofford College than Yeshivath Beth Moshe (98% vs. 81%)
  • The average total grant financial aid received by Wofford College students is 206.8% larger than aid received Yeshivath Beth Moshe ($36,005 vs. $11,735)
